Adirondack Regional Airport is a public use airport located four nautical miles northwest of the central business district of Saranac Lake, in Franklin County, New York, United States. The airport is owned by the Town of Harrietstown and is situated in the north-central Adirondacks two miles from Lake Clear. It is served by one commercial airline, subsidized by the Essential Air Service program.
  • Owner: Town of Harrietstown
  • Location: Harrietstown, New York
  • Airport type: Public
  • Serves: Northern Adirondacks
  • Elevation AMSL: 1,663 ft / 507 m
